Ingredients

Original recipe (1X) yields 6 servings

  • 1 (12 ounce) package dry fettuccine pasta

  • 1 (15 ounce) jar Alfredo sauce

  • 3 tablespoons lemon juice

  • 1 tablespoon drained capers

  • ½ teaspoon lemon zest

  • ½ teaspoon ground black pepper

  • 2 (5 ounce) cans tuna, drained and flaked

Directions

  1.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add fettuccine and boil until tender yet firm to the bite, about 8 minutes. Drain and set aside.

  2. Stir together Alfredo sauce, lemon juice, capers, lemon zest, and pepper in a small saucepan. Stir in tuna; cook over medium heat until heated through, about 5 minutes. Serve over fettuccine.
